Great list and idea for a video Shaggy! I went over my collection and here are my picks, many overlaps because I've bought some of these off your recommendations. 1. Dungeon Petz - The base mechanics centered around growing pets wrapped in a traditional resource management euro makes for a very unique feeling game 2. Galaxy Trucker - The fact that it's real-time, has a goofy theme, is tile laying, even the galaxy expedition portion of it makes it feel very distinct and unique 3. Carnival zombie - I've not played many tower defense games, but the multi-night aspect 4. Tzolk'in - It's really traditional worker placement, but with a huge twist in the rotating gear. It makes you think not only about where to place your workers, more so where they will end up. 5. Alchemists - Similarly to Galaxy Trucker and Dungeon Petz, this has a very unique theme of brewing potions as alchemists, but it's effectively a deduction - sudoku like game entrapped in a worker placement/resource management euro. It even has bidding in there to meet the customer needs, very different and unique game. 6. Skymines - Obviously it shares a lot of DNA (read all of it) with Mombasa, but that is out of print. The only other contender using Pfister's cool card-play mechanic which has you place cards to take resources or actions in rows, and you can only get one row back each round is Blackout Hong Kong. But Skymines is wrapped in an area-control / company shareholding/worker placement euro ! A very unique mix. 7. Pax Pamir 2nd edition - The mix of tableau building, area control, faction allegiance, political control feels very unique to me 8. Woodcraft - The dice contract fulfillment puzzle and the ways you can mix and match them makes this one stand out to me 9. Inis - As far as area control games go, the combination of drafting, how meaningful it is and the different winning conditions make this feel almost chest-like. 10. Targi - The worker placement junction puzzle mixed with the tableau building, especially with the expansion.

I personally love both games but I like Robinson Crusoe more. RC is an adventure survival game with emergent storytelling -- it is gameplay forward. This War of Mine is horror survival with a story forward approach. The focus is on the experience. I would suggest watching my playthroughs of these two games to really get a feel for how they play.
